android - 如何配置 Android 模拟器以显示屏幕上的按钮,如新的 Galaxy Nexus?

标签 android android-emulator

我想将我的应用程序转换/调整到 Android 4.0。 为此,我计划在支持它的设备上使用 ActionBar。 所有 Android 版本 >= 3.0 都这样做。此外,没有硬件菜单按钮的设备似乎会自动在操作栏上显示“菜单”按钮。

当我使用 API 级别 13 在模拟器上测试我的应用程序时,这确实按预期工作...... ...但不知何故,我无法将模拟器设置为在 API 级别 14(Android 4.0)上模拟手机时以相同的方式运行。 当我尝试将“Hardware Back/Home keys”设置为 false 时,根本没有 没有按钮(不在屏幕上,也没有提供键盘由模拟器)。

我在“Galaxy Nexus”的一些屏幕截图和视频中看到,它也在 ActionBar 上显示了一个“菜单”按钮......就像 Honeycomb 平板电脑一样,但我在某种程度上没有成功与模拟器相同,这使得理解我的 UI 如何在 Andoid 4.0 手机上工作变得更加复杂。

编辑: Here is an image that is showing the On-Screen back and home buttons I would like to see in the emulator:

最佳答案

该问题似乎已通过 SDK (R16) 的最新更新得到解决。 只需将您的 SDK 和 ADT 更新到 R16,然后使用更新的 Android 4.0 系统镜像创建一个新的模拟器。

关于android - 如何配置 Android 模拟器以显示屏幕上的按钮,如新的 Galaxy Nexus?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7873532/

相关文章:

android - 未校准的磁力计问题

c# - 使用 Android 模拟器从外部应用程序通过 COM 测试 AT 命令

javascript - whatsapp://send?text= 不起作用

android - 如何获取adb devices打印的设备名称?

android - 如何超过方法代码的 65535 字节限制

android - 为什么每次运行我使用 GPS 查找当前位置的 android 应用程序都会遇到崩溃?它显示了一个力关闭

Android: "Bad Request-Invalid Hostname"从模拟器访问本地主机时

android - Android Studio 应用检查器的问题

android - 您如何使用蓝牙开发 Android 应用程序?

android - 如何为 Android 应用小部件指定标签/名称